Salah and Alexander-Arnold Involved in Heated Liverpool Training Incident

Liverpool stars Mohamed Salah and Trent Alexander-Arnold had a tense moment during training ahead of their Champions League clash with Paris Saint-Germain at Anfield. Cameras caught the two exchanging words, with Salah appearing relaxed and amused, while Alexander-Arnold looked visibly frustrated. Their teammates had to step in to keep things from escalating.

Tensions Rise Before PSG Clash

Liverpool head into their second-leg tie against PSG with a slight advantage after securing a 1-0 victory in Paris, thanks to a late Harvey Elliott strike. Arne Slot’s men were also indebted to Alisson Becker’s goalkeeping heroics that night. Now, they need just a draw at Anfield to book their place in the quarter-finals.

Ahead of the match, Liverpool held an open training session, where the exchange between Salah and Alexander-Arnold took place. As the squad walked off the pitch, footage from BeanymanSports captured Alexander-Arnold engaged in what appeared to be a stern discussion with Salah. While the Egyptian winger laughed, his teammate’s body language suggested frustration. The situation escalated to the point where Ibrahima Konaté stepped in to create some space between them, while Elliott intervened to ease the tension.

It remains unclear what sparked the disagreement, but it likely stemmed from a competitive training exercise. Whatever the cause, Liverpool’s manager will want to ensure that any lingering frustration doesn’t spill onto the pitch against PSG.

Uncertainty Over Liverpool Contracts

While the immediate concern is overcoming PSG, Liverpool are also facing significant long-term challenges. Salah, Alexander-Arnold, and Virgil van Dijk are all in the final months of their contracts, creating uncertainty over their futures at the club.

Since arriving at Liverpool, Slot has repeatedly faced questions about these expiring deals, but time is running out for resolutions. The situation with Alexander-Arnold, in particular, has drawn attention, as the right-back has been strongly linked with a move to Spanish giants Real Madrid.

Former Liverpool and Real Madrid star Steve McManaman recently weighed in on the speculation, suggesting he understands why Alexander-Arnold might be considering a fresh challenge abroad.

He told The Athletic: “If he feels as if he wants to experience a new lifestyle, new language, new culture, I’d have no qualms at all. It would be a huge miss for Liverpool but if he wants to do it, I’d completely respect him and be very proud because he’s a local lad who has done incredibly well, which is what I love more than anything.

“Real Madrid are a bigger, more professional, well-run machine now than when I joined. They have the new stadium, and some of the best players in the world. Of course, Jude Bellingham is there, who is close to Trent. He’s won every trophy manageable with Liverpool.”
